Definition of Cosmetology

Los Molinos CA hair stylist cutting hairCosmetology is an occupation that is everything about making the human body look more attractive through the application of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that numerous cosmetology schools are referred to as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ic may be anything that improves the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, most states require that you take some type of specialized training and then become licensed. Once licensed, the work environments include not only Los Molinos CA beauty salons and barber shops, but also such places as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have acquired experience and a clientele, open their own shops or salons. Others will begin servicing clients either in their own residences or will go to the client’s residence, or both. Cosmetology college graduates have many titles and are employed in a wide range of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As earlier mentioned, in most states working cosmetologists must be licensed. In a few states there is an exception. Only those conducting more skilled services, for example h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people working in cosmetology and less skilled, including shampooers, are not required to become lic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ees

nail techs training at Los Molinos CA beauty schoolThere are basically two options available to get c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s generally take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are offered if you wish to focus on just one area, for example hair coloring. A degree program will also most likely include management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to manage a parlor or other Los Molinos CA business. Higher deg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whichever type of training program you opt for, it’s essential to make certain that it’s certified by the California Board of Cosmetology. Many states only certify schools that are accredited by certain reputable agencies, for example the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). We will review the benefits of accreditation for the school you choose in the following section.

Online Cosmetology Courses

student attending online beauty school in Los Molinos CAOnline cosmetology classes are advantageous for Los Molinos CA students who are employed full-time and have family obligations that make it difficult to attend a more traditional school. There are many web-based cosmetology school programs available that can be attended via a desktop comput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ional beauty schools are typically fast paced given that many programs are as brief as six or eight months. This means that a considerable amount of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are dealing with the same amount of material, but you’re not spending many hours outside of your home or travelling to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s important that the program you choose can provide internship training in local salons and parlors so that you also get the hands-on training required for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ills needed to work in any facet of the cosmetology industry. So be sure if you decide to enroll in an online school to confirm that internship training is provided in your area.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s important to make certain that the cosmetology training program you select is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for securing student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not offered in 96055 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, many Los Molinos CA employers will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more positively upon individuals with accredited training.

Does the School have a Great Reputation?  Every beauty school that you are seriously evaluating should have a good to excellent reputation within the industry. Being accredited is an excellent beginning. Next, ask the schools for references from their network of businesses where they have placed their students. Confirm that the schools have high job placement rates, showing that their students are highly sought after. Visit rating services for reviews together with the school’s accrediting agencies. If you have any contacts with Los Molinos CA salon owners or managers, or someone working in the trade, ask them if they are acquainted with the schools you are considering. They may even be able to propose others that you had not considered. And finally, consult the California school licensing authority to see if there have been any complaints submitted or if the schools are in complete compliance.

What’s the School’s Focus?  Many cosmetology schools offer programs that are broad in nature, concentrating on all facets of cosmetology. Others are more focused, offering training in a particular specialty, such as h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s often bro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s essential that you enroll in a school that specializes in your area of interest. If your intention is to be trained as an esthetician, make sure that the school you enroll in is accredited and well regarded for that program. If your vision is to launch a hair salon in Los Molinos CA, then you need to enroll in a degree program that will teach you how to be an owner/operator. Selecting a highly regarded school with a weak program in the specialty you are pursuing will not provide the training you need.

Is Enough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and mastering cosmetology skills and techniques requires plenty of practice on volunteers. Ask how much live, hands-on training is provided in the cosmetology lessons you will be attending. Some schools have salons on site that make it possible for students to practice their developing talents on volunteers. If a beauty academy furnishes minimal or no scheduled live training, but rather relies mainly on utilizing mannequins, it might not be the most effective alternative for developing your skills. So look for alternate schools that offer this kind of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  Once a student graduates from a cosmetology school, it’s important that he or she gets support in securing that very first job. Job placement programs are an important part of that process. Schools that offer assistance develope relationships with Los Molinos CA employers that are looking for skilled graduates available for hiring. Verify that the schools you are looking at have job placement programs and inquire which salons and establishments they refer students to. In addition, find out what their job placement rates are. High rates not only confirm that they have wide networks of employers, but that their programs are highly respected as well.

Is Financial Aid Available?  Most cosmetology sch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Find out if the schools you are investigating have a financial aid office. Talk to a counselor and learn what student loans or grants you might qualify for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ships available to students as well. If a school meets each of your other qualifications with the exception of cost, do not discard it as an alternative before you learn what financial aid may be provided.

Los Molinos, California

According to the United States Census Bureau, the CDP has a total area of 2.2 square miles (5.7 km2), of which, 2.2 square miles (5.7 km2) of it is land and 0.02 square miles (0.052 km2) of it (1.06%) is water.

The 2010 United States Census[5] reported that Los Molinos had a population of 2,037. The population density was 918.6 people per square mile (354.7/km²). The racial makeup of Los Molinos was 1,581 (77.6%) White, 0 (0.0%) African American, 39 (1.9%) Native American, 7 (0.3%) Asian, 2 (0.1%) Pacific Islander, 321 (15.8%) from other races, and 87 (4.3%) from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 537 persons (26.4%).

There were 786 households, out of which 242 (30.8%) had children under the age of 18 living in them, 366 (46.6%) were opposite-sex married couples living together, 88 (11.2%) had a female householder with no husband present, 43 (5.5%) had a male householder with no wife present. There were 70 (8.9%) unmarried opposite-sex partnerships, and 1 (0.1%) same-sex married couples or partnerships. 232 households (29.5%) were made up of individuals and 120 (15.3%) had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.55. There were 497 families (63.2% of all households); the average family size was 3.18.
